The movement against ‘size zero movement occurred after the death of Luisel Ramos from
anorexia in August, 2006, Madrid Fashion Week banned size zero models the following month,
and the Milan fashion show took the same action shortly afterward, banning models with a body
mass index (BMI) of 18 or below. As a result, five models were banned from taking part. Italian
fashion labels Prada, Versace and Armani have agreed to ban size zero models from their
Rahman 8
catwalks. As of 2007, the British Fashion Council promoted the creation of a task force to
establish guidelines for the fashion industry. They also urged fashion designers to use healthy
models. An Italian inquiry reported in September 2007 that up to 40 percent of models could
have an eating disorder and made a number of suggestions to promote health, yet ruled out a ban
on size-zero models. Under the new self-regulation code drawn up in Italy by the government
and designers. all models in future shows will be "full bodied, healthy and radiant Mediterranean
types". Larger sizes 14 and 16 - would also be introduced into shows and all models under the
age of 16 would also be banned. Fashion designer Giorgio Armani has given support to the effort
to eliminate ultra-thin models. "The time has now come for clarity. We all need to work together
against anorexia."
In September 2010, Victoria Beckham banned size zero models from her New York Fashion
Week runway show. Herself a size two (UK size 6) at 36 years old, she reportedly barred 12
models from appearing in her show after deeming them "too skinny". Her fashions will be
modelled by "healthy girls who look 'realistic' to encourage a positive image to impressionable
teens."
Israel banned underweight models in March 2012. Their law stipulates that women and men
hired as models must be certified by a physician as having a body mass index (BMI) of no less
than 18.5. The legislation also requires the inclusion of an informational note in adverts using
photos manipulated to make models look thinner. There were divergent views on the ban within
the Israeli fashion industry. One modelling agent, who had helped promote the bill, suggested
that the fall in typical dress sizes for models in the preceding 15–20 years amounted to "the
Rahman 9
difference between death and life". However, another described the law as "arbitrary" and "not
appropriate for every model".

No one talk about the harmful effect of ‘obesity in pregnancy’. Sometimes gaining over weight
increases the possibility of diabetes in pregnancy. With few exceptions, women are expected to
gain weight during their pregnancy, because their bodies must be able to support a baby’s
growth. However, how much weight a woman should gain depends on her pre -pregnancy
weight. The American College of Obstetricians and Gynecologists advises that overweight
women, or those with a BMI of 25 to 29.9, should gain around 10 pounds less than the average
woman, or between 15 and 25 pounds. In contrast, an obese woman with a BMI of over 30
should only gain between 11 and 20 pounds for her entire pregnancy.
